When setting up Xmas lights, having a well-organized team can make a substantial distinction. Mark at least one ground crew member and one roof covering crew participant for a more effective and protected installment process.
The roof team member can focus on securing lights to greater locations and browsing the roofing securely. This department of functions ensures a smoother process, reducing the moment spent on back-and-forth movements and enhancing overall performance. While blow-up designs can add a wayward touch to your holiday display, they might not be the most suggested selection because of potential issues.
Blow-up decors are well-known for being difficult to manage and secure effectively. Strong winds or stormy climate can easily displace them, bring about a discouraging and taxing reinstallation procedure. Take into consideration selecting even more steady and time-efficient alternatives, such as lighted numbers or well-anchored decors. Take one-time measurements of your home so you recognize the number of Xmas lights you'll need. (There's nothing even worse than hanging a string and understanding it just covers two-thirds of the intended area.) Evaluate your power circumstance. Know where the electrical outlets are and figure out if you'll need to run exterior-grade extension cables from the outlet to the last destination Recommended Site where the Xmas lights will hang.

The ESFI says metal ladders can carry out power, which isn't great when connecting in Christmas lights. Measure your home utilizing our tips over to identify the number of light strands you require. Ensure you have sufficient additional to connect in the lights as soon as hung. When you're prepared to include Xmas lights to your house, start with the acme and function your method back and forth and afterwards down.

Protect your Xmas lights firmly however without damaging the wires. Avoid securing your Christmas lights with nails and staples due to the fact that they enhance the probability of spoiling them. Identify what tools and hooks you need to hang the Xmas lights. Use clips that secure onto seamless gutters and bricks or slide under roof covering shingles to hold light bulbs in position.

Prior to whipping out your lights, do some planning. Don't just start hanging them around your house and wish you have the appropriate amount to finish the work. First, identify where you want the lights. Do you desire them to mount your entryway? Do you want them lining your roofing system, along the eaves, framing home windows or doors, or around your deck? After you have actually decided which locations you desire to decorate, get hold of a tape procedure.

Add all measurements with each other to identify the number of backyards of lights you require to acquire or the amount of hairs you need to dig out of storage. If you utilize an extension cord to connect the lights to the source of power, take its length into factor to consider when computing dimensions. If you have Christmas lights from previous years that you intend to utilize, be certain they are still in great form.
If you require to get brand-new lights, make certain you buy ones that are identified for exterior use., it is commonly risk-free to attach up to 25 hairs of LED lights, while no more than 3-6 hairs of incandescent lights should be strung together.

After you know they function, connect clips while the lights still on the ground, and see to it the clips are all facing the very same direction. Keep in mind: versatile light clips are great for any sort of light. Once you have all of your clips affixed to your lights, it is time to begin hanging them.
If this is your approach, ensure that all lights are pointed in the exact same direction (either up or down), and be certain the clips are all facing in the exact same instructions also. If you're connecting your lights to roof shingles, the very same concept applies. You'll simply be positioning them on the roof with the clips flipped in the opposite instructions than if you were connecting them to your gutters.
When hanging lights anywhere, just set up one strand at a time, and make sure to not let lights struck walls or ladders while doing so. You may require an assistant to assist you. It's time to light it up. Plug in your lights, and enjoy the view. If you have any light bulbs that aren't lighting, inspect to see to it whether they are screwed in securely or if they have stressed out.
